Django

본 토픽은 현재 준비중입니다. 공동공부에 참여하시면 완성 되었을 때 알려드립니다.

프로젝트 폴더 구조

 

manage.py

 프로젝트에 django 명령을 실행하기 위해 필요한 명령행 유틸리티입니다. python manage.py {명령어} 형식으로 실행합니다. 굳이 manage.py 파일을 실행해야하는 이유는 manage.py 파일이 django 프로젝트의 설정 파일의 위치를 Python 인터프리터에게 알려주기 때문입니다.

[컨테이너 폴더]

 이 폴더명은 프로젝트를 생성할 때 입력하는 프로젝트명으로 생성됩니다. 폴더 내부에 settings.py와 wsgi.py 파일이 있는 폴더가 바로 컨테이너 폴더입니다. 이 폴더명은 django 또는 test 등 django 내부 패키지명과 동일하게 생성하면 충돌이 발생할 수 있습니다.

__init__.py

 Python 인터프리터가 이 폴더가 Python 패키지로 간주하도록 알려주는 역할을 하는 빈 파일입니다.

wsgi.py

 웹 서버와 통신하기 위한 WSGI 모듈의 진입점입니다.

  • 봤어요 (0명)

댓글

댓글 본문
버전 관리
Hyunseok Lim
현재 버전
선택 버전
graphittie 자세히 보기